The question of nomenclature and classification regarding technicians, their education and their functions as used around the world has often given rise to controversy and misunderstanding. This report arises from a survey of current practice and is intended to help identify manor difficulties and differences and give clearer insight into the problem. It includes a critical analysis of the problem and contains summaries of the systems for training technicians and technician engineers in many countries.
